      The lack of options for the player in possession was very disappointing.  Too few of the Reds ahead of him made angled runs, meaning we often played in straight lines, which suited Wigan's defence.  Suarez typically pulls wide (to the left), which creates a gap in the middle.  But without Stevie G, who's willing to fill it?
